Sapporo Mayor Announces City's Intention To Bid For 2026 Winter Olympics

The mayor of Sapporo, Japan, "announced his city’s intention to bid for the 2026 Winter Olympics," according to the AP. Sapporo, on Japan’s northernmost island Hokkaido, "hosted the Winter Olympics in 1972." Sapporo Mayor Fumio Ueda told a city assembly meeting Thursday that “hosting the Winter Games will lead Sapporo to a new stage.” The announcement comes at a time when "public opinion in some European cities has turned against bidding for the Olympics" in light of the $51B price tag associated with the 2014 Sochi Winter Games (AP, 11/28).
